Global warming is increasing the temperature of the lower atmosphere. How will
this affect the amount of moisture in the air?
A) increase moisture
B) has no effect on moisture
C) decrease moisture


Sagot :

Final answer:

Rising temperatures lead to increased water vapor in the atmosphere, impacting climate change.


Explanation:

Increasing temperatures will lead to more evaporation and more water vapor in the atmosphere. Water vapor is a greenhouse gas and its increased presence may cause further warming in a positive feedback loop. However, if the water vapor results in more clouds, more solar radiation will be reflected, acting as a possible negative feedback.
